Full-Stack Development with FARM Stack Online Course

Full-Stack Development with FARM Stack Online Course

Full-Stack Development with FARM Stack Online Course

This course guides you through building a complete full-stack application using modern technologies. You’ll work with FastAPI to build CRUD endpoints, configure middleware, and manage CORS and HTTP settings, while mastering React concepts such as functional components, state management with hooks, API integration with Axios, and responsive design. Along the way, you’ll practice debugging with developer tools, analyzing network calls, and pushing code to GitHub. Combining frontend skills in HTML, CSS, JSX, and React with backend development in Python, FastAPI, MongoDB, and NoSQL, this hands-on course prepares you to confidently create FARM stack applications for real-world use.

Who should take this course?

This course is ideal for aspiring web developers, students, and professionals who want to build full-stack applications using the FARM stack (FastAPI, React, and MongoDB). It’s best suited for those with basic programming knowledge who are looking to gain hands-on experience in both front-end and back-end development. Whether you’re a beginner aiming to start a career in full-stack development, a developer expanding your skill set, or an entrepreneur wanting to build scalable web apps, this course will help you master the FARM stack for real-world projects.

What you will learn

  • Learn how to build APIs using the FAST API framework
  • Learn how to use NoSQL and MongoDB to connect frontend and backend
  • Learn how to build front-end applications using ReactJs
  • Learn how to style the frontend using the Bootstrap framework
  • Learn different debugging and troubleshooting techniques
  • Learn how to make a website responsive

Course Outline

Introduction and Environment Setup

  • Introduction to the Course
  • Installation and Setup for Backend Development
  • Setting Up FastAPI

Developing RESTful APIs

  • NoSQL and MongoDB CRUD Operation
  • Get API DB Connection
  • Model Creation and Converter
  • Create API
  • Update Delete Endpoints
  • Pushing Code to GitHub
  • Enable Cors

Developing Frontend with ReactJs and Bootstrap

  • Installation and Setup
  • Creating First React App
  • Project Structure
  • Creating Header
  • Creating Form
  • Creating Footer
  • Loading and Adding Data
  • Deleting Data
  • Displaying All Data
  • Refresh the Data
  • Update Data
  • Reusing Code to Add Update
  • Refresh Data on Delete

Reviews

No reviews yet. Be the first to review!

Write a review

Note: HTML is not translated!
Bad           Good

Tags: Full-Stack Development with FARM Stack Practice Exam, Full-Stack Development with FARM Stack Online Course, Full-Stack Development with FARM Stack Training, Full-Stack Development with FARM Stack Tutorial, Learn Full-Stack Development with FARM Stack, Full-Stack Development with FARM Stack Study Guide,